Released in 2003, Wild Herd is an action and drama film directed by Valeriy Rozhko, running about 81 minutes.

What it’s about. Under the hoofs of a wild herd, a correspondent of a metropolitan newspaper dies. His girlfriend Kupava, (also a journalist), trying to find out the circumstances of the death of her colleague, becomes a witness to the conspiracy of the "first minister of the country" and the young deputy who are about to apply a new "scheme" of robbing their people.

Who’s in it. Wild Herd stars Egor Beroev, Vladimir Gostyukhin, Pyotr Benyuk and Andrey Melnikov, among others.
